The ACTF Releases 2019 – 2020 Annual Report

The ACTF has released its Annual Report, outlining its corporate governance, production funding, education, outreach and financial performance for 2019 - 20. During the financial year the ACTF committed $2,230,000 to production investment via distribution advances and equity. First Day Wins Prestigious Rose d'Or Award

Four-part Australian children's drama First Day (Epic Films) has been awarded a prestigious Rose d'Or Award for best Children and Youth Series.

Thalu Composers Win APRA AMCOS Screen Music Award

Ned Beckley and Josh Hogan have received the ‘Best Music for Children's Television' prize at this year's APRA AMCOS Screen Music Awards for Episode 5 of children's adventure-drama series Thalu.

Who Got Funded by the ACTF in a Bumper Year for the Development of Australian Children's Television?

The ACTF has received a record number of applications for development support in 2020 and committed over $500,000 across the year, to support the development of film and television projects which aim to engage, stimulate and entertain Australian children.
